Pay attention to the details Write a direct answer to the question. Restate the question in a way that includes the answer. Explain your reasons in sequence. Give examples to expound your reasoning. Use citations to give credit to your sources. Conclude with your position in the answer. The syntax of the questions environment is very similar to that of the itemize and enumerate environments. Each question is typed by putting the command \question before it. Typesetting exams in LaTeX - Overleaf Overleaf learn Typesettingexams Overleaf learn Typesettingexams
how would you typeset Q and A? \newcounter{question} \setcounter{question}{0} \newcommand{\question}[1]{\item[Q\refstepcounter{question} textit{#1}} \newcommand{\answer}[1]{\item[A\thequestion.] # 1} \begin{itemize} \question{What is your favorite color?}
